The huge tax and spending invoice central to President Trump’s agenda is one step nearer to actuality.
After weeks of negotiations and 49 consecutive votes that began Monday morning, the senate permitted President Trump’s signature home coverage invoice round lunch time Tuesday. It now goes again to the Home of Representatives the place Republican Speaker Mike Johnson must reconcile the senate modifications together with his members’ competing priorities.
Michael Ricci has had an extended profession in republican politics, together with working as Speaker Paul Ryan’s communications director and Speaker John Boehner’s Chief Speech author. We talked with him concerning the stakes, and the invoice’s prospects within the Home.
